For example, if I wanted to explain it to a 6th grader, how might I do this in an easy way to understand?Can someone give me an analogy for pork barrel legislation?Pork barrel legislation is taking something out of the pork barrel (the barrel you put the pork into to preserve it) for your people. IOW, if I present a bill to pay for a new bridge in my area, even if it doesn't go anywhere (say it's a "bridge to nowhere), my constituents will see me as a congress person who can get money to their area. I got them some of the pork. (Some pork barrel money is used for projects that are actually needed and useful.)Can someone give me an analogy for pork barrel legislation?Pork is something added to a bill.
